The leader of the Universities of Wisconsin has decided to close two more branch campuses due to declining enrollment

Two more Universities of Wisconsin two-year branch campuses will close by next year and more shutdowns might be on the way as students continue to opt for four-year colleges and online classes, Universities of Wisconsin President Jay Rothman announced Tuesday. Rothman told reporters during a conference call that he has decided to shutter UW-Milwaukee's Washington County campus and UW-Oshkosh's Fond du Lac campus.

UW-Milwaukee has another branch campus in Waukesha County, about 30 miles southeast of the Washington County campus. UW-Oshkosh has another branch campus in Menasha, about 35 miles north of Fond du Lac, and UW-Oshkosh's four-year campus lies about 20 miles north of Fond du Lac. Declining enrollment forced Rothman to close UW-Platteville's campus in Richland Center this summer.
